Four-year-old Sydney Harrison was honoured on Jan. 15 as Volunteer of the Year with Growing Together, a program for families with young children. Sydney sometimes helped her mother, Roxanne Harrison, deliver wellness and cooking kits to homes around the community in a program last fall. Sydney was very helpful, said Brenda Hall, executive director of Growing Together. "So I just thought that was special."
